build: create JSON files containing image info

The JSON info files contain details about the created firmware images
per device and are stored next to the created images.

The JSON files are stored as "$(IMAGE_PREFIX).json" and contain some
device/image meta data as well as a list of created firmware images.

An example of openwrt-ramips-rt305x-aztech_hw550-3g.json

    {
      "id": "aztech_hw550-3g",
      "image_prefix": "openwrt-ramips-rt305x-aztech_hw550-3g",
      "images": [
        {
          "name": "openwrt-ramips-rt305x-aztech_hw550-3g-squashfs-sysupgrade.bin",
          "sha256": "db2b34b0ec4a83d9bf612cf66fab0dc3722b191cb9bedf111e5627a4298baf20",
          "type": "sysupgrade"
        }
      ],
      "metadata_version": 1,
      "supported_devices": [
        "aztech,hw550-3g",
        "hw550-3g"
      ],
      "target": "ramips/rt305x",
      "titles": [
        {
          "model": "HW550-3G",
          "vendor": "Aztech"
        },
        {
          "model": "ALL0239-3G",
          "vendor": "Allnet"
        }
      ],
      "version_commit": "r10920+123-0cc87b3bac",
      "version_number": "SNAPSHOT"
    }

menu "Global build settings"
config JSON_ADD_IMAGE_INFO
bool "Create JSON info files per build image"
default BUILDBOT
help
The JSON info files contain information about the device and
build images, stored next to the firmware images.

#!/usr/bin/env python3
import json
import os
import hashlib
def e(variable, default=None):
return os.environ.get(variable, default)
json_path = "{}{}{}.json".format(e("BIN_DIR"), os.sep, e("IMAGE_PREFIX"))
with open(os.path.join(e("BIN_DIR"), e("IMAGE_NAME")), "rb") as image_file:
image_hash = hashlib.sha256(image_file.read()).hexdigest()
def get_titles():
titles = []
for prefix in ["", "ALT0_", "ALT1_", "ALT2_"]:
title = {}
for var in ["vendor", "model", "variant"]:
if e("DEVICE_{}{}".format(prefix, var.upper())):
title[var] = e("DEVICE_{}{}".format(prefix, var.upper()))
if title:
titles.append(title)
if not titles:
titles.append({"title": e("DEVICE_TITLE")})
return titles
if not os.path.exists(json_path):
device_info = {
"id": e("DEVICE_ID"),
"image_prefix": e("IMAGE_PREFIX"),
"images": [],
"metadata_version": 1,
"supported_devices": e("SUPPORTED_DEVICES").split(),
"target": "{}/{}".format(e("TARGET"), e("SUBTARGET", "generic")),
"titles": get_titles(),
"version_commit": e("VERSION_CODE"),
"version_number": e("VERSION_NUMBER"),
}
else:
with open(json_path, "r") as json_file:
device_info = json.load(json_file)
image_info = {"type": e("IMAGE_TYPE"), "name": e("IMAGE_NAME"), "sha256": image_hash}
device_info["images"].append(image_info)
with open(json_path, "w") as json_file:
json.dump(device_info, json_file, sort_keys=True, indent=" ")
